F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.

Senior Software Engineer, Integrations
Air-Tek Manufacturing (Pty) LtdSenior / Staff Software Engineer for the Integrations team at Air-tek. Delivering production-grade integrations and leading technical improvements with a diverse team in Toronto.
Tech Stack
Tools & technologiesCloudDockerJavaScriptMicroservicesMongoDB.NETNode.jsReactTypeScriptVue.js
About the role
Key responsibilities & impact- Own end-to-end delivery: discovery, design, implementation, testing, deployment, and support
- Break down ambiguous problems into clear technical plans, milestones, and deliverables
- Identify risks early (data quality, partner constraints, operational failure modes) and drive mitigations
- Design maintainable integration components and contribute to shared patterns and libraries
- Improve engineering standards through code reviews, design reviews, and documentation
- Champion best practices in integration design, testing, deployment, and monitoring
- Participate in on-call and incident response as needed; improve runbooks and alerting
- Drive durable fixes and reliability improvements that reduce recurring incidents
- Collaborate with Delivery to align on scope, sequencing, and timelines; communicate tradeoffs clearly
- Partner with Product to clarify requirements and help shape roadmap items that improve integration flexibility
- Coordinate with other Engineering teams when work impacts shared services or downstream systems
Requirements
What you’ll need- Proven track record delivering complex systems or integrations in production
- Strong system integration fundamentals (APIs, enterprise patterns, cloud architectures)
- Experience designing for reliability (idempotency, retries/backoff, rate limiting, data validation)
- Strong debugging and root-cause analysis skills
- Demonstrated technical leadership at the team level: setting direction, influencing standards, and driving high-leverage initiatives
- Experience creating leverage via shared patterns/frameworks/tooling
- Strong ability to align stakeholders and drive decisions across competing priorities
- Lead the design and execution of enterprise CI/CD pipelines utilizing GitHub Actions and Docker to containerize and deploy microservices
- Familiarity with our stack (or similar): React, Vue.js, TypeScript, Node.js, C#/.NET Core, MongoDB, Docker
- Experience with Agile/Scrum methodologies; familiarity with tools like Jira and Confluence
Benefits
Comp & perks- Competitive compensation and growth opportunities in a fast-scaling company
- Work on meaningful problems that power the backbone of the airline industry
- Build production-grade software that scales globally and impacts millions of passengers
- Collaborate with brilliant engineers in a high-trust, low-ego environment
- Operate with autonomy and ownership - your ideas will shape our products
- Exposure to modern technologies, cloud environments, and complex system design
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
system integrationAPIscloud architecturesreliability designdebuggingroot-cause analysisCI/CD pipelinesGitHub ActionsDockermicroservices
Soft Skills
technical leadershipstakeholder alignmentdecision drivingproblem breakdowncommunicationcollaborationrisk identificationbest practices advocacyincident responsedocumentation